Peptides Research and Medicinal Development: Modern Directions

New advances in peptide research are significantly driving pharmaceutical development programs. Particularly, there's a heightened attention on cyclic peptides for improved durability and uptake. Moreover, innovative technologies like computational synthesis and solid-phase peptides fabrication are expediting the detection of lead pharmaceutical agents. Lastly, investigating peptides conjugates and delivery systems remains a critical domain of active investigation to enhance therapeutic potency and lessen undesirable effects.

Delving into the Boundaries of Amino Acid Chain Production and Assessment

Emerging advances are progressively reshaping the field of peptide creation . Advanced methodologies , including combinatorial strategies, allow the efficient construction of increasingly intricate peptide sequences. Furthermore , modern investigative instruments , such as mass spectrometry and nuclear resonance analysis, are giving unprecedented insights into peptide folding and behavior. These combined researches are opening the way for transformative advancements in drug development and materials engineering .
